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
104700030 56 690665150 0122362
6617 44620
6617 44620
053506 303138 16783 27611592113
All about undefined
Interested in learning more?
6617 44620
053506 303138 16783 27611592113
See more
35141 66249557451 76
3005 043 8087
See more
19 49798445399 7829410214
560005806 287703566 37211401 3309340
See more